Web12 nov. 2024 · According to the ACA: A full-time employee works an average of at least 30 hours per week or 130 hours per month for more than 120 days in a year. A part-time employee works an average of fewer than 30 hours per week or fewer than 130 hours per month for more than 120 days in a row.
